About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Dickson
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Dickson is a public, two-year institution located in the rural area of Dickson, Tennessee. The college reports a total enrollment of 1,287 students (IPEDS 2023), a completion rate of 76% (IPEDS 2023), and a retention rate of 71% (IPEDS 2023). It has a quality score of 61.67 out of 100 and is part of Tennessee's statewide network of applied technology colleges.
The college offers a diverse range of certificate programs across skilled trades and healthcare. Programs include Welding Technology/Welder, Heating, Air Conditioning, Ventilation and Refrigeration Maintenance Technology/Technician, Machine Tool Technology/Machinist, Licensed Practical/Vocational Nurse Training, Cosmetology/Cosmetologist, General, Pharmacy Technician/Assistant, and Drafting and Design Technology/Technician. All programs lead to one-to-two-year certificates designed for direct workforce entry.
Dickson is located approximately 35 miles west of Nashville, giving graduates access to Middle Tennessee's growing job market. The college serves as an important workforce development resource for Dickson County and the surrounding rural communities, training students in trades and healthcare fields with strong regional demand.
Accreditation: Council on Occupational Education
